Abstract
In this work, a photo-induced method for obtaining silver nanoparticles (SNPs) was investigated using UV LED, xenon lamp and sodium lamp excitation. Silver colloidal solutions were prepared using autopolymerizable resin and AgNO3 in an ethanol solution. This study shows that the combination of pulsed laser ablation in liquids with previous UV–visible illumination provides a simple, applicable and flexible technique for the fabrication of nanoparticles of 5–8 nm in size.
